BEACh

Binge Eating and Chromium Study

BEACh is a pilot research study funded by the National Alliance for Research on Schizophrenia and Depression (NARSAD) (http://www.narsad.org/) and run by the UNC Eating Disorders Program. This study aims to advance our understanding of the effects of a dietary supplement, chromium picolinate on eating behavior, mood, body weight, and glucose regulation in individuals with binge eating disorder.
